
Devastating tornadoes strike US killing dozens
Tornadoes have ravaged central and southern states in the U.S., resulting in at least 33 deaths. The state of Missouri has been particularly hard hit, with at least 12 recorded deaths.
In Kansas, at least eight people died due to a 50-vehicle pileup caused by a severe dust storm.
One fatality was reported in Oklahoma, while three people lost their lives in a car accident in Amarillo, Texas, also related to a dust storm, according to CBS.
Officials in Mississippi have confirmed six deaths due to the storm in the counties of Walthall, Covington, and Jefferson Davis.
